Market & Strategy Risk
The main failure mode
Trend-following loses in choppy, mean-reverting markets. When price oscillates around a level rather than moving in a direction, the signal flips repeatedly. The program buys after each move up and sells after each move down, paying the spread and the impact each time, and none of the positions run long enough to pay for the ones that did not.
This is the ordinary cost of the strategy, not an edge case. The payoff shape is many small losses funded by a few large gains. The 2010s were largely range-bound and the CTA category performed poorly across the decade.
Expect extended flat-to-negative periods. They are not evidence that something has broken.

Model risk
The strategy is calibrated on historical data. Trend persistence is documented over 50 years and 100+ markets, but crypto microstructure is young and evolving. The effects being harvested could weaken as these markets mature and as more capital chases them.
Simulated performance flatters
All performance before 27 May 2026 is simulated on historical execution data, net of modelled commission, slippage and funding. Modelled frictions are not real frictions. Live trading reveals costs a backtest does not contain: queue position, adverse selection, and the price impact of being the marginal participant in a thin market.
Live execution has tracked the backtest within approximately 7 basis points per day since inception. That is a sample of weeks.
Concentration of outcome
The portfolio is diversified by risk contribution, not by outcome. In the simulated window one sector, Metals, produced 37% of the return while Energy detracted.
That is the construction working as designed. It also means a given year's result may be dominated by a small number of sleeves, so twelve months of data is not evidence that the diversification is delivering, in either direction.
Volatility targeting cuts both ways
Scaling positions down as volatility rises bounds the risk profile. It also means the program is smallest exactly when a violent move is underway, so in a sharp sustained rally it participates less than a static-weight portfolio would.

What would make the thesis wrong
- Trends stop persisting in crypto as the market matures and the flow that created them is arbitraged away.
- Correlations between sectors rise toward the levels seen inside crypto-only portfolios, removing the diversification the construction depends on.
- Tokenized RWA markets stay too thin to carry a meaningful risk allocation, removing the three sleeves that supply most of the low correlation.
- Live execution costs come in materially above modelled costs.
